Ticket: Config drift on Threshline workers

Heads up — since we swapped the old homegrown queue for Threshline, a few worker boxes in the Dunmoor pool have drifted from the baseline config. Probably leftover manual tweaks from the migration weekend. Symptoms: uneven job pickup and the occasional stuck retry. Please compare any box users complain about against the baseline. The expected configuration values are below.

deployment values, tafog-kagap:
wenath:
  pin: 4244
  metrics_host: metrics.wenath.lumicsys.internal
  tenant: istix
  seal: seal_10585894

Hey — the nightly inventory reconciliation job for Tallowbarn compares warehouse counts against the storefront ledger and flags drifts over 2%. It runs from the jobs box via cron at 02:15. If it dies midway, it's safe to rerun; everything is idempotent. Logs land in /var/log/tallow-recon. The job pulls warehouse counts from the Quartzline API, which needs a credential in the job's environment file. Add the line below to /etc/tallowbarn/recon.env before the first run.

sealed setting: COURIER_KEY5=a0434

Quarterly Planning Note — Pilot Churn

For your review: the Bramblewick pilot lost 14% of enrolled customers this quarter, concentrated among smaller accounts onboarded in the first wave. Exit interviews cite setup friction rather than pricing. Remediation work is underway under Tomas. The strategic implications are summarised in the confidential note directly below.

management briefing: Project Ulavan slips by two quarters because of the staffing delay.

## Account Recovery — Trailnote Offline Mode

When a surveyor's Trailnote app has been offline for 30+ days, their local credentials expire and sync refuses to resume. Don't make them wipe the device — all their unsynced field data lives there! Instead, open the support console, pick "Offline Reinstate," and enter their handle. The console will ask for the support team's shared recovery passphrase before issuing a reinstatement token. Use the one below.

unlock words, bagaf-fajeg: zorael-kelax-fraath-quenix-eliok-sileth-aldmir-wenir-druiel